Now that A-Levels at Hardenhuish are finished, Y13 Student Casper, and friend Aidan thought they would celebrate by taking on something completely different… cycling 1,000km in 10 days from Bilbao back to the UK! Please see further information from Casper
We caught the ferry from Portsmouth to Bilbao on Saturday evening, survived the 33-hour crossing, and we’re now on the road. Over the next 10 days we’ll be cycling across northern Spain, through France, and on to St Malo before heading home. It’s going to be a huge challenge, but one we’re really excited about.
We’re doing it all to raise money for Dorothy House, an amazing local charity that provides incredible care and support to people with life-limiting illnesses and their families. It’s a cause that’s really close to our hearts, and every donation will make a difference.
